Official Google Blog: More transparency in customized search results:
Lest anybody think that I am anti-google based on my previous post, here is a great example of google doing the right thing by increasing transparency on how they customize search results. Now all that would be needed is an opportunity for endusers to opt out of geo and recent search tracking on this information screen.
